SayPro Supply Chain Optimization: Ensure a Smooth Flow of Materials and Finished Products Throughout the Supply Chain

Objective: To optimize SayPro’s supply chain by streamlining the movement of raw materials, managing inventory effectively, and ensuring timely delivery of finished products to customers. The goal is to reduce inefficiencies, minimize delays, and improve overall supply chain performance, ensuring that production targets are met and customer satisfaction remains high.


1. Raw Material Sourcing and Supplier Management

A. Supplier Relationship Management

  • Establish Strong Partnerships:
    • Build strong, long-term relationships with key suppliers to ensure a reliable supply of high-quality raw materials (wood, upholstery, screws, etc.). This fosters trust and ensures priority during peak production periods.
    • Negotiate favorable terms such as competitive pricing, lead times, and discounts based on volume, helping SayPro maintain cost-effectiveness while securing the necessary materials.
  • Diversify Suppliers:
    • Identify and establish relationships with multiple suppliers for each raw material to mitigate the risk of supply disruptions. This will help SayPro avoid delays in production if one supplier faces challenges or delays.
    • Consider working with local suppliers to minimize shipping times and costs, as well as reduce dependency on international suppliers where possible.

B. Just-In-Time (JIT) Inventory System

  • Minimize Excess Inventory:
    • Implement a Just-In-Time (JIT) inventory system to reduce the amount of inventory on hand, decreasing storage costs while ensuring raw materials are available when needed for production.
    • Work closely with suppliers to maintain consistent delivery schedules, so raw materials arrive just before they are required in the production process.
  • Forecast Demand:
    • Use historical sales data and production schedules to forecast raw material requirements and align procurement strategies accordingly. This helps avoid overstocking or understocking, ensuring a steady flow of materials.

2. Production Process Optimization

A. Streamline Production Scheduling

  • Production Planning:
    • Develop a detailed production schedule that accounts for machine availability, raw material supply, and labor requirements. This ensures that chair production runs smoothly and that deadlines are met without overloading the workforce or machines.
    • Incorporate buffer times in the production schedule to accommodate unexpected delays or issues.
  • Capacity Management:
    • Regularly evaluate production capacity to ensure that machines and labor are being utilized efficiently. Adjust the production schedule as needed to balance high-demand periods with capacity constraints.

B. Automation and Machine Efficiency

  • Use Advanced Manufacturing Techniques:
    • Leverage advanced manufacturing technologies, such as automation, AI-driven process control, or predictive maintenance tools, to enhance production efficiency and reduce downtime.
    • Optimize machine setup and changeover times to reduce delays in production and make the best use of available time and resources.
  • Machine Maintenance:
    • Schedule regular maintenance for production equipment to minimize unexpected downtime. Implement a predictive maintenance program that uses sensor data to predict and prevent machine failures before they occur.
    • Ensure that employees are trained to troubleshoot and resolve minor issues quickly to avoid production disruptions.

3. Inventory Management and Control

A. Implement an Inventory Management System

  • Real-Time Inventory Tracking:
    • Use an automated inventory management system to track raw materials and finished products in real-time. This will enable SayPro to keep accurate records of stock levels, locations, and movement of materials, helping avoid stockouts or excess inventory.
    • Use barcodes, RFID, or other tracking technology to streamline inventory monitoring and ensure efficient product tracking throughout the supply chain.
  • Safety Stock:
    • Maintain a calculated level of safety stock for key materials to buffer against supply chain disruptions. Regularly review safety stock levels to ensure they are aligned with demand and production cycles.

B. Improve Warehouse Management

  • Warehouse Layout Optimization:
    • Optimize the layout of the warehouse to reduce material handling time and increase the speed of order fulfillment. Group similar materials and finished products together for easy access and efficient picking.
    • Implement a robust storage system that maximizes space and ensures materials are stored in the most accessible and organized manner.
  • Automated Picking and Packing:
    • Implement automated picking and packing systems, where feasible, to reduce human error and speed up the process of getting products ready for shipment.

4. Logistics and Distribution Optimization

A. Streamline Distribution Channels

  • Partner with Reliable Logistics Providers:
    • Establish strong partnerships with reliable shipping and logistics companies that can ensure timely deliveries to both domestic and international customers.
    • Explore multiple logistics options (e.g., ground, air, sea) based on the urgency of deliveries and cost considerations. For international shipments, work with experienced partners to navigate customs and import/export regulations smoothly.
  • Real-Time Shipment Tracking:
    • Implement real-time shipment tracking systems for both raw materials and finished goods. This will allow SayPro to monitor delivery times, identify potential delays, and inform customers proactively about shipping status.

B. Optimize Distribution Routes

  • Route Planning:
    • Optimize delivery routes to reduce transportation costs and improve delivery times. Work with logistics partners to use the most efficient routes and avoid unnecessary delays.
    • Leverage route optimization software to plan shipments and deliveries to minimize fuel consumption, vehicle wear and tear, and transportation costs.
  • Local Distribution Centers:
    • If applicable, consider establishing local distribution centers in key regions to reduce shipping times and costs for both domestic and international markets.
    • This can also help ensure that chairs are readily available for retailers and customers, improving customer satisfaction through faster delivery times.

5. Data-Driven Decision Making

A. Use Analytics to Track Performance

  • Supply Chain Performance Dashboards:
    • Implement supply chain performance dashboards that provide real-time data on inventory levels, production schedules, raw material orders, shipping status, and more. Use these dashboards to monitor the health of the supply chain and identify areas for improvement.
  • Key Performance Indicators (KPIs):
    • Track KPIs such as lead times, order fulfillment rates, production efficiency, inventory turnover, and customer delivery times to assess supply chain performance. Use these metrics to identify bottlenecks and optimize operations.

B. Forecasting and Demand Planning

  • Demand Forecasting:
    • Use historical data and trends to forecast demand for the chairs and other products, ensuring that SayPro orders the right amount of raw materials and adjusts production schedules accordingly. This helps avoid both overproduction and stockouts.
    • Implement machine learning models or data-driven analytics tools to improve the accuracy of demand forecasting.

6. Risk Management and Contingency Planning

A. Identify and Mitigate Risks

  • Supply Chain Risks:
    • Identify key risks within the supply chain, such as supply disruptions, transportation delays, or machine breakdowns. Develop contingency plans to mitigate these risks, such as sourcing from alternative suppliers or adjusting production schedules in response to disruptions.
  • Diversify Sources and Suppliers:
    • Avoid reliance on a single supplier for critical raw materials by diversifying suppliers and sourcing from multiple regions. This will help ensure the supply of materials in case of regional disruptions, such as weather-related delays or supply shortages.

B. Continuously Review and Improve

  • Ongoing Evaluation:
    • Regularly review supply chain performance and look for areas where further optimization is possible. This might include adopting new technologies, automating manual processes, or renegotiating supplier contracts to achieve better terms.
  • Feedback Loops:
    • Establish feedback loops with suppliers, production teams, and customers to continuously improve the supply chain. Incorporating feedback helps identify weak points and opportunities for better alignment and efficiency.

Outcome:

By optimizing SayPro’s supply chain, the company will:

  • Achieve a smoother flow of materials and finished goods, reducing delays and bottlenecks in production and distribution.
  • Improve operational efficiency, leading to cost savings, increased productivity, and higher profitability.
  • Ensure timely deliveries, enhancing customer satisfaction and retention by meeting customer expectations for on-time shipping and high-quality products.
  • Enhance overall supply chain resilience, ensuring SayPro can adapt to disruptions or changes in demand with minimal impact on operations.
